mongo查询以动态获取对象字段

时间:2020-05-21 11:22:16

标签: mongodb aggregation-framework mongo-projection

我有以下文档,其中有一个filed4作为对象。在该对象内部,值位于键值对中。键和值是动态的,即用户输入的内容都将被保存。 用户还将提供键以及值。

collection{
    field1:value1,
    field2:value2,
    field3:value3,
    field4:{
            k1:v1,
            k2:v2,
            k3:v3,
            k4:v4,
            k5:v5
         },
    field5:value5
 }

我在创建mongo查询时需要帮助,该查询可以动态提取此对象字段而无需在查询中指定它们。

field1:value1,
field2:value2,
field3:value3,
k1:v1,
k2:v2,
k3:v3,
k4:v4,
k5:v5
field5:value5

0 个答案:

没有答案
相关问题